  "summary": "arXiv:2607.26064v1 Announce Type: new Abstract: AI systems are becoming autonomous research agents that generate hypotheses, design experiments, and produce discoveries at scales beyond human oversight. As seen by increased submissions to ML venues, the verification gap between scientific output and our ability to check it is already widening, and autonomous agents make it worse by magnitudes given human-agent asymmetry.
